摘要: 通过前 2 篇文章,您一定对 JUnit 有了一个基本的了解,下面我们来探讨一下 JUnit4 中一些高级特性。一、 高级 Fixture上一篇文章中我们介绍了两个 Fixture 标注,分别是 @Before 和 @After ,我们来看看他们是否适合完成如下功能:有一个类是负责对大文件(超过 5... 阅读全文
posted @ 2015-12-10 20:51 门罗的魔术师 阅读(160) 评论(0) 推荐(0) 编辑
摘要: 我们继续对初级篇中的例子进行分析。初级篇中我们使用Eclipse自动生成了一个测试框架,在这篇文章中,我们来仔细分析一下这个测试框架中的每一个细节,知其然更要知其所以然,才能更加熟练地应用JUnit4。一、 包含必要地Package在测试类中用到了JUnit4框架,自然要把相应地Package包含进... 阅读全文
posted @ 2015-12-10 20:32 门罗的魔术师 阅读(130) 评论(0) 推荐(0) 编辑
摘要: 我 们在编写大型程序的时候,需要写成千上万个方法或函数,这些函数的功能可能很强大,但我们在程序中只用到该函数的一小部分功能,并且经过调试可以确定,这 一小部分功能是正确的。但是,我们同时应该确保每一个函数都完全正确,因为如果我们今后如果对程序进行扩展,用到了某个函数的其他功能,而这个功能有bug的话... 阅读全文
posted @ 2015-12-10 20:07 门罗的魔术师 阅读(119) 评论(0) 推荐(0) 编辑